Problem
Professionals and organizations rely on paper business cards, which are static, difficult to update, and provide no insight into how contacts are engaged. This leads to manual data entry, missed follow‑ups, and limited ability to track networking effectiveness.
Solution
KADO offers a digital business card platform that lets users create interactive, multimedia cards accessible via QR code, NFC, wallet links, or direct URLs. The platform automatically captures contact information during meetings and syncs it with major CRMs (Salesforce, HubSpot, Dynamics) and email/calendar tools, eliminating manual entry. Built‑in analytics track card views, engagements, and lead conversions, giving individuals and teams measurable networking metrics. Role‑based access controls, SOC 2 Type II certification, and GDPR‑compliant data handling ensure enterprise‑grade security and privacy. The service scales from a free solo plan to paid team and enterprise subscriptions, providing centralized card management, branding, and advanced workflow integrations.
Target Audience
Primary customers are solo professionals, sales and business development teams, and enterprise organizations that need scalable, secure digital networking and CRM‑integrated contact management.
Features
- Interactive digital cards with video, personalized buttons, and offline QR codes
- Multiple sharing methods: QR, NFC, wallet, and direct link
- Automatic lead capture with CSV export and bidirectional CRM sync (Salesforce, HubSpot, Dynamics)
- Email and calendar integrations for Outlook and Google to log communications and meetings
- Team management tools, role‑based access, and centralized branding for multiple users
- Analytics dashboard showing card views, engagement metrics, and relationship tracking
- Enterprise security features: SOC 2 Type II, GDPR compliance, encrypted storage, and data processing agreements
- Add‑on options such as NFC cards, extra paper‑card scans, HRM integration, and custom subdomains
